Volkswagen Taigun and Virtus Recalled

Volkswagen India has announced a recall for two of its popular cars – the Taigun and the Virtus. This is to check and fix a possible problem with the seat belts.

A total of 961 cars, made between 1 December 2021 and 31 May 2025, are included in this recall.

What’s the Issue?

  • There might be a crack in the metal frame of the rear seat belts (both left and right sides).
  • Some cars might have wrong seat belt parts fitted in the front and rear.

What Should Owners Do?

If you own a Taigun or Virtus made in this time period, visit the nearest Volkswagen service centre. The check and replacement (if needed) will be done free of cost.

Also, Skoda India has recalled some cars too – Kushaq, Slavia, and Kylaq – for the same reason.
